About This Vintage 1966 Edition

"Engineer Handtools" is a comprehensive technical manual published by the Departments of the Army and the Air Force in June 1966. This manual serves as an essential guide for military engineers and technicians, detailing the use and maintenance of various handtools. Organized into chapters covering driving, cutting, drilling, measuring, and more, this manual provides in-depth instructions and safety precautions. Its practical approach makes it a valuable resource for understanding the intricacies of handtool operations in military settings.
